Content is appropriate, focusing on engineering projects with no concerning themes.
The channel features complex engineering projects like 'Super Capacitor Wind-Up Plane' and 'Building a Mechanical Battery'. There is no evidence of violence, sexual content, scary imagery, or manipulative clickbait in the titles or descriptions provided. The content is consistently focused on the technical aspects of building and experimenting.
Primarily long-form content, minimizing addictive scrolling behavior.
Only 2 out of the last 100 uploads are Shorts, making up 2.0% of recent content. The channel primarily focuses on longer, in-depth project videos, which encourages focused viewing rather than rapid, short-form consumption.
Content is complex, best suited for older children and teens interested in engineering.
The projects, such as 'Optimising a Stirling Engine Bike' and 'Building a Turbine Car', involve advanced engineering concepts and tools. While fascinating, the technical depth and hands-on work are beyond the comprehension and capabilities of young children, making it less clear for a broad age range.
High educational value, demonstrating practical engineering and problem-solving.
The channel actively teaches about physics, mechanics, and engineering principles through practical demonstrations, such as in 'Electromagnetic Aircraft Launcher' and 'Flying a Plane Powered by Thin Air'. Viewers learn about design, fabrication, and iterative improvement in real-world applications.
This channel showcases an individual building and experimenting with various engineering projects, from planes to bikes. It is designed for viewers interested in how things work and the process of mechanical creation. The content is largely project-based and demonstrates practical application of scientific principles.
Parents should be aware that while the content is highly educational and safe, the projects are complex and involve tools and processes that are not suitable for young children to replicate without significant adult supervision. The channel also includes sponsored segments, which are clearly disclosed.
